Range Rover Classic Heater Core: Symptoms, Replacement, and Repair Guide

The heater core in a Range Rover Classic is a compact heat exchanger that routes coolant through a small radiator inside the vehicle’s cabin. Over time, wear, leaks, and blockages can reduce heating performance or cause coolant damage. This guide covers common symptoms, diagnostic steps, replacement procedures, parts, labor considerations, and proactive maintenance to help owners address heater core issues efficiently and safely.

Symptoms Of Heater Core Problems In Range Rover Classic

Heater core issues often manifest through a set of telltale signs. Recognizing these early can prevent further damage to the cooling system or engine. Key symptoms include persistent coolant loss with no obvious leaks, a sweet or salty smell inside the cabin, foggy or damp dashboards, coolant temperature fluctuations, and reduced or irregular cabin heat. In some cases, coolant may bubble within the reservoir, indicating air pockets or head gasket concerns. If any of these symptoms appear, a thorough inspection is warranted to determine if the heater core is the source.

Common Causes Of Heater Core Failures

Understanding the root causes helps prioritize maintenance. Heater core failures in Range Rover Classics are commonly due to aging and corrosion of copper or aluminum cores, internal leaks from cracked end tanks, failed hose connections, poor coolant maintenance, and clogged passages from rust or sediment. Overheating due to a malfunctioning thermostat or radiator can also stress the heater core. Regular coolant changes with the correct specification can extend core life and prevent premature failures.

Diagnostic Checklist To Confirm A Heater Core Issue

A structured diagnostic approach reduces unnecessary repairs and ensures the heater core is the true culprit. Start by checking coolant levels and looking for obvious external leaks. Pressure-test the cooling system to reveal seepage. Inspect heater hoses for cracks, swelling, or soft spots. With the dashboard temperature set to hot, feel for heat at the heater core inlet and outlet hoses; weak or absent flow often indicates a blockage or pump issue. If the cabin remains cool despite hot coolant, the problem may lie in the blend door, thermostat, or control actuators rather than the heater core itself.

Repair Or Replacement Options

Replacement is typically required when diagnostic results confirm a leak or significant blockage. Depending on the vehicle’s year and configuration, access to the heater core may require dash removal or partial disassembly of the HVAC plenum. In some Range Rover Classic models, the heater core is located behind the glove box or under the dash, necessitating careful disassembly to avoid damaged sensors or wiring. Replacing the heater core usually involves draining the cooling system, disconnecting hoses, removing the old core, installing the new unit, and flushing the system to remove air and debris.

Step-By-Step Replacement Guide

Note: This is a high-level overview. Always refer to the vehicle’s service manual for model-specific steps and torque specs. Work safely, block the vehicle, and dispose of coolant properly.

  1. Prepare the vehicle: disconnect the battery and drain the cooling system by opening the drain valve or removing the lower radiator hose, depending on the model.
  2. Access the heater core: remove panels, glove box, or dash components as required to reach the heater core housing without damaging electrical connectors.
  3. Disconnect hoses: label and detach the heater core inlet and outlet hoses. Cap or seal open ports to prevent contamination.
  4. Remove the old core: unbolt or unclip the heater core mounting brackets, carefully slide out the core, and inspect the surrounding seals for wear.
  5. Prepare the new core: inspect the new unit for defects, ensure seals are intact, and apply anti-seize to fasteners if recommended.
  6. Install the new core: slide the core into place, reconnect hoses, and reseal any gaskets or plenum components. Reassemble dashboard components in reverse order of disassembly.
  7. Refill and bleed coolant: fill the cooling system with the correct coolant mix, then bleed air from the system following the manufacturer’s procedure to avoid air pockets.
  8. Test: reconnect the battery, start the engine, and run to operating temperature. Check for leaks, verify heater performance, and monitor temperature control accuracy.

Alternative Repair Strategies

For models with low-cost access to the heater core, some specialists offer core repair services such as end-tank reseals or internal core cleaning. While these options can reduce cost, they carry risks of incomplete sealing or future leaks if the core’s integrity is compromised. For older Range Rover Classics, a complete core replacement is often the most reliable solution to restore consistent cabin heat and system cooling performance.

Maintenance Tips To Extend Heater Core Life

Proactive maintenance can prevent early heater core failure. Regularly check coolant levels and top up with the correct specification. Schedule periodic coolant flushes per the manufacturer’s guidelines to remove rust and debris. Use filtered or distilled water if the coolant system is vulnerable to mineral buildup. Inspect heater hoses for signs of wear and replace as needed. Keep an eye on heater performance; sudden loss of cabin heat or unusual smells should prompt inspection before core deterioration accelerates.

Safety And Environmental Considerations

Coolant is toxic and environmentally hazardous. Wear gloves and eye protection during service. Properly drain and dispose of used coolant at an appropriate recycling facility. When working around airbags, wiring for the HVAC system, or the dash, follow vehicle-specific safety cautions and disconnect the battery to minimize the risk of accidental deployment or electrical shorts.
